Bruce Middle

$38 per 1/2 hour lesson; Mon., Tues., & Wed.

“Music is to be enjoyable, and last a lifetime. I make learning music fun and clear from your first chord to advanced improvising. I focus on your musical interests and provide you with the tools you will need to achieve your goals.”

Bruce Middle is an educator, composer, publisher, and performing and recording artist with over 35 years in the industry. He has taught since 1985, and teaches beginners through advanced (ages 10 to adult) in all styles.


Member of: MENC, IAJE, BMI, WAMA
Education: NVCC, GMU, UMW

Bruce is the Professor of Guitar and Director of the Guitar Ensemble at The University of Mary Washington, and is an 11-time WAMA (Washington Area Music Award) nominee.

Joanna Smith

$38 per 1/2 hour lesson; Mon. & Tues.

“Everybody needs a bass player.”

Joanna Smith has been playing upright and electric bass professionally for the past 10 years, and has taught since 2014. She received her BA in music from the University of Mary Washington in 2012, spending four years in the UMW Philharmonic and Jazz band.

She can often be seen playing in Fredericksburg and abroad with various groups in styles ranging from jazz to bluegrass and rock.

Her most recent projects include playing for Ladia, The Kingbolts, and Jon Tyler Wiley and his Virginia Choir, and she regularly plays in the Riverside Center for the Performing Arts’ pit orchestra. She is a member of AFM Local 161-710.
